I went back to Airline Apps and checked Delta's postings as I clearly remember what you are talking about. There used to be a disclaimer at the bottom clarifying that PIC time means ONLY that time in which you have signed for the aircraft as PIC. However, it is no longer listed there.

The regs --
FAR 61.51:
"A ..commercial, or airline transport pilot may log pilot in command flight time for flights-...
(1)(i)when the pilot is the sole manipulator of the controls of an aircraft for which the pilot is rated"
